| The
Stand
The actual stand itself
did not impress me at all and left a lot to be desired.
It was obvious seating bolted onto a former terrace which
meant the leg room was sparse to say the least. No roof
meant fans would be left open to the elements, but we were
lucky since it was nice and sunny!
